The Art World’s Operational Bottleneck

The art world has mastered aesthetics and experience. But behind the canvas, the infrastructure tells a different story. Many galleries and institutions still rely on outdated processes: manual paperwork, patchy data systems, slow communications. It’s a friction-heavy model that discourages new buyers, slows down international expansion, and limits market liquidity.

At Convelio, we believe the real opportunity for AI in the art world lies not in replacing art and artists, but in addressing operational inefficiencies. That’s why we’re putting AI and cutting edge technology to work where it matters most: behind the scenes, powering leaner, faster, and more transparent logistics. From accelerating quotes in Shipping, to increasing visibility in Storage, to reducing manual data entry in Inventory, AI is enhancing every layer of our service.

A Logistics Hub Designed for Today’s Art Market

We’ve launched a state-of-the-art storage facility in Paris, now serving Carpenters Workshop Gallery as their key continental European base, and available to a broad range of art professionals. Together with our London facility, it forms part of Convelio’s growing network of smart storage hubs. Powered by Convelio’s Tier 1 Warehouse Management System (WMS) and fully integrated with our art Inventory Management Software (IMS) and AI-driven tools, our integrated storage solutions bridge physical logistics excellence with a smart digital infrastructure.

For a gallery handling complex, large-scale works, this means fewer bottlenecks and more room to scale.

Here’s what that looks like in practice:

  1. Smart Inventory Management with real-time visibility, automated workflows, document management and customs visibility for compliance.
  2. Seamless Storage Operations with instant shipping quotes, one-click storage and release requests, automated artwork image uploads, and real-time condition checks as items enter the facility.
  3. AI Quoting Agent that reads PDFs or text and engages in real time dialogue to confirm details - producing instant, bookable quotes.

These tools are already live, already driving impact, and helping Carpenters Workshop Gallery free up time, reduce friction, and reinvest in what they do best: producing and curating exceptional work.
